Market Sizing, Growth Estimates, and CAGR Projections

Based on current industry data and realistic assumptions, the South Korea cat wet food market was valued at approximately KRW 450 billion

(USD 400 million) in 2023. The market has demonstrated consistent growth, fueled by rising pet ownership rates—estimated at 29% of households owning cats—and increasing consumer expenditure on pet health and wellness.

Assuming an ann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 8.5%

over the next five years (2024–2028), driven by rising disposable incomes, urbanization, and premiumization trends, the market is projected to reach around KRW 700 billion

(USD 620 million) by 2028. Longer-term projections (2028–2033) suggest a CAGR of approximately 7%, with the market potentially surpassing KRW 950 billion (USD 840 million) by 2033, contingent on macroeconomic stability and evolving consumer preferences.

Value Chain Analysis: From Raw Materials to End-User Delivery

The value chain encompasses the following stages:

  1. Raw Material Sourcing:

    High-quality proteins (chicken, fish, beef), grains, vegetables, and functional ingredients sourced domestically or internationally. Emphasis on sustainable and traceable sourcing is rising.

  2. Manufacturing:

    Processing facilities equipped with advanced extrusion, sterilization, and packaging technologies. Quality assurance protocols, including HACCP and ISO standards, are integral.

  3. Packaging:

    Innovations include eco-friendly pouches, cans, and trays with resealable features, enhancing shelf life and convenience.

  4. Distribution:

    Multi-channel logistics involving third-party distributors, direct online sales, and retail partnerships. Cold chain logistics are critical for maintaining product integrity.

  5. End-User Delivery:

    Pet owners purchase through supermarkets, pet specialty stores, or online platforms. Subscription models and direct-to-consumer channels are gaining traction.

Revenue models are primarily based on product sales, with additional income from subscription services, private label offerings, and value-added services such as personalized nutrition plans.

Cost Structures, Pricing Strategies, and Risk Factors

Major cost components include raw materials (~40%), manufacturing (~25%), packaging (~10%), distribution (~15%), and marketing (~10%). The industry leans towards premium pricing, with profit margins ranging from 12% to 20%, depending on product positioning and scale.
